Men's Tennis Opens ITA Southeast Regional Play Thursday
Oct. 17, 2007
LEXINGTON, Ky. - The University of Memphis men's tennis team will open its 2007 ITA Southeast Regional play, Thursday, at the University of Kentucky. Three Tigers will play in the first round of the 256-player tournament, while senior Amrit Narasimhan received a seed in the tournament and will have to wait out two rounds of singles to find out who his first opponent is. Sophomore Charlie Ramsay will open the Tigers' weekend at 9:00 a.m., Thursday, against Auburn's Pawel Dilaj. Teammate Spencer Heflin will follow at 11:00 a.m., facing Alabama's Houssam Yassine, while freshman Michael Gaerthoeffner will open at 12:30 p.m. against Murray State's Nick Ksiezpolski.
